HIGH COURT MALAYA MELAKA
COSTWIN CONSTRUCTION SDN BHD – Appellant
Versus
TEH CHONG PING & ANOTHER CASE – Respondent
JUDGMENT
Introduction
[1] This judgment is in respect of 2 Originating Summonses. They are:
(a) MA-24C-1-02/2023 is Costwin Constructions Sdn Bhd's ("Costwin") application to set aside the adjudication decision dated 25 January 2023 ("the AD") which was held in favour of CJV Trading Enterprise ("CJV"). This application is made pursuant to s 15(b) and s 15(d) of the Construction Industry Payment and Adjudication Act 2012 ("CIPAA 2012"). (Costwin's setting aside application).
(b) MA-24C-3-04/2023 which is CJV's enforcement application to enforce the AD pursuant to s 28 CIPAA 2012 (CJV's enforcement application).
[2] Costwin's setting aside application and CJV's enforcement application will collectively be referred to as "the applications". Parties agreed that the applications be heard together.
[3] After hearing submissions by both parties I decided to dismiss Costwin's setting aside application and allow CJV's enforcement application. Costwin has appealed to the Court of Appeal against both decisions.
